what went wrong
i was trying to put text on a banner and it looks funny. I have tried to adjust depth many times and it still looks funny

Re: what went wrong
Your banner component does not match the outline. It is smaller than the banner outline by quite a bit. The v-carve is dropping off the edge of the component by the full depth of the material at the top...there is literally no component there for it to be projected onto.

Re: what went wrong
Just go back to your v-carve toolpath and uncheck the "Project onto Model" block and it will carve the way you want it. joe
